- Taxicab Service
Taxicabs are available from the lower level curb front of Chicago-O'Hare International Airport (ORD) and Chicago-Midway International Airport (MDW) airports. There are no flat rates because all taxicabs run on meters. The fare is approximately $45 from O'Hare and $30 from Midway to the downtown area. For wheelchair accessible vehicles, please call United Dispatch at 1-800-281-4466.
- Public Transportation
Chicago-O'Hare International Airport (ORD) is served directly by the Blue Line (CTA 'L' train route) and drops you off right at Terminal 2's doorstep! Blue Line trains serve O'Hare at all times (24 hours per day, seven days per week). Trains operate every few minutes during the day and every 15-30 minutes overnight. Blue Line Route Guide
Chicago-Midway International Airport (MDW) is served directly by the Orange Line (CTA 'L' train route) and drops you off just steps from the airport terminal! Follow signs from the train station to the airport. Orange Line trains serve Midway from early morning through late-evening hours, every day. Trains operate every 6-15 minutes throughout the day while there is train service. Orange Line Route Guide
